Repairing windows is best left to professionals with the tools and knowledge to perform it safely. If you attempt to repair or replace a window without the proper instruction could result in injury.

A broken window seal is usually the cause of foggy windows. To fix the problem professionals will make an opening, then place a defogging product between the panes and apply an entirely new seal.

Glass pane cracked and cracked

It is not simple to repair a cracked pane of double-pane glass. You must take action as soon as possible to avoid further damage. While there are DIY solutions to repair a crack in a window, it's best to leave the replacement of a damaged glass pane to experts with the tools and expertise to do the job right.

If the crack is very small it is possible to cover it with a thin layer clear nail polish. The adhesive properties of the polish will help to keep it from growing further and also provide an external seal. If you don't have nail polish, a small strip of masking tape or packing tape will do the trick. To get the best results, extend the tape beyond the edges of the crack.

Alternately, you can use epoxy to repair a crack in your double-pane window. It's more laborious, but will give you the strongest bond and best appearance. If you decide to go with epoxy, prepare the windows first by taking off any glazing or upvc door repairs Near me hardened glazing. You will also need to get rid of any shards glass and scrape away any remaining putty.

Overheated windows are another common reason for double-pane windows cracking. When the metal of the frame heats up faster than the glass, it creates stress on the window and could cause it to break. The excessive heat can also cause condensation inside your home. This will reduce the effectiveness of your window.

A poor installation can also lead to cracks in your double pane window. Installers might have used the wrong adhesive, or they may not have left enough space between two panes. This causes the glass panes to expand and contract in different ways over time.

Stress can cause cracks in your window. The crack can be difficult to repair. These cracks usually start in the corner of the window, and then grow to cover the entire pane. This kind of crack can be caused by sudden temperature changes for instance, when you turn on your heating in the winter months or the reverse.

Glass Misty Panes

Double-glazed windows can be an excellent investment. They can improve the insulation of your home, decrease the noise from outside, and also save your money on energy bills. However, sometimes they'll be somewhat worse particularly if you've got a problem with condensation.

Misted window glass is caused by a buildup of water that is difficult to fix. Luckily, you can usually avoid the issue by regularly cleaning your windows and keeping humidity levels balanced within your home. You could also try using a hairdryer on the glass (from an appropriate distance) to remove any stagnant water droplets that have formed between the panes.

If your window is getting misted or if the issue persists, it is possible to consult a professional. In this situation it could be because the window seal has failed. This means that new moisture may be creeping between the two panes and reduces the efficiency of thermal heating.

A leaky seal is the most frequent reason for condensation between double panes of glass. A flaw in the seal between the frame and glass allows moisture to enter the insulating area of your window. This could result in the glass to fog, resulting in condensation. This could be a costly error, as the loss of insulation will lead to high energy bills.

You can prevent the issue by having your windows professionally repaired or replacing them altogether. Broken Frame

The frame of your window could break or crack due to the same types of damage that could affect a pane of glass. This can be caused by a variety of things including the expansion and contraction of the material due to temperature and weather fluctuations. If a window frame has a hole in it or is beginning to rot, it may need to be replaced altogether.

In some cases an expert can fix the frames of your windows in order to avoid needing to replace them completely. They can do this by filling holes, resealing joints, and repairing any damage to the wood that is beginning to break down. Based on the severity of the damage, this can often be done quickly and easily.

It is possible to fix the corners of the window frame without disassembling the whole frame. You will need to carefully look at the corners of the frame, and if you can move the joint slightly and scrape away any glue that is old, then apply new glue, and then clamp it shut. This will help repair the damage and prevent it from getting worse in the future.
